## From Raw Data to Actionable Insights: Your API Explained (and How to Use It)
Our API is designed to be your direct conduit to powerful SEO insights, transforming raw data points into actionable strategies. Imagine having the ability to programmatically request and receive crucial information on keyword rankings, competitor backlink profiles, technical SEO audits, and even content performance metrics directly within your own applications or dashboards. Instead of manually navigating various tools, you can leverage our API to automate data collection, analyze trends over time, and build custom reports tailored precisely to your clients' or your own blog's needs. This programmatic access empowers you to build sophisticated SEO tools, integrate data seamlessly into existing workflows, and ultimately make more informed, data-driven decisions that propel your content to the top of search rankings.
Utilizing our API is straightforward, even for those with limited coding experience. We provide comprehensive documentation, including detailed examples and use cases, to guide you through the process of making your first API call. You'll typically start by obtaining an API key, which authenticates your requests. From there, you'll learn about our various endpoints – specific URLs that provide access to different types of data. For instance, you might use one endpoint to retrieve keyword volume for a specific list of terms, and another to fetch the top-ranking URLs for a particular competitor. We also offer SDKs (Software Development Kits) in popular programming languages to simplify integration, allowing you to focus on extracting maximum value from the data rather than the intricacies of HTTP requests. The possibilities for automation and deep analysis are truly limitless once you harness the power of our API.
An Amazon scraping API allows developers and businesses to programmatically extract product information, prices, reviews, and other data from Amazon's website. These APIs simplify the process of gathering large datasets, bypassing the complexities of web scraping and CAPTCHAs. Utilizing an amazon scraping api can be crucial for market research, competitor analysis, price tracking, and building custom applications that require Amazon data.
## Beyond the Basics: Practical Extraction Tips, Common Questions, and What's Next for E-commerce Data
Navigating the complex world of e-commerce data extraction requires a nuanced approach beyond just basic scraping. Practical tips include employing dynamic rendering solutions for JavaScript-heavy sites, utilizing robust proxy rotations to avoid IP blocking, and implementing smart rate limiting to prevent server overload. Consider using specialized libraries like Puppeteer or Playwright for headless browser automation when dealing with intricate web elements or single-page applications. Furthermore, always prioritize ethical scraping practices, respecting robots.txt files and understanding the terms of service for each website. For common questions, users often ask about managing anti-bot measures, handling CAPTCHAs, and ensuring data quality – all of which can be addressed with advanced techniques and continuous monitoring of your extraction pipelines.
Looking ahead, the future of e-commerce data extraction is deeply intertwined with advancements in AI and machine learning. We anticipate more sophisticated tools capable of automatic schema inference, adapting to website changes with minimal human intervention, and providing deeper insights through natural language processing (NLP) of product descriptions and customer reviews. The rise of real-time data needs will also push for more efficient and continuous extraction methods, moving beyond batch processing. Furthermore, ethical considerations and data privacy regulations, such as GDPR and CCPA, will continue to shape how data is collected and utilized, emphasizing the importance of transparent and compliant extraction strategies. Staying abreast of these technological and regulatory shifts will be crucial for any serious e-commerce data practitioner.
